Symptoms

Loss of adhesion of  coating system on substrate or loss of intercoat adhesion.

Cause

  • Insufficient cleaning / degreasing
  • Unsuitable system
  • Insufficiently sanded
  • Damp substrate or high moisture content
  • Condensation on substrate at application

Solution
Coating layers that are not sound shall be removed. After the correct pretreatment, a new system should be applied.  Apply suitable primer/base stain and top coat(s).
